OVERVIEW

The Cornerstone Society is comprised of forward-thinking supporters who give to the University or its related foundations through estate or financial plans, or other deferred gift arrangements. With a planned gift, you may be able to make a greater impact than you thought was possible during your lifetime.

MEMBERSHIP CRITERIA

Qualifying gifts may be for any amount and may be directed to any school, student life program, or University-related foundation. They may be designated for a specific purpose, such as a scholarship, fellowship, or faculty chair. Conversely, gifts may be designated as unrestricted to help the University address needs that cannot be foreseen today. If you prefer your gift to remain anonymous, it can be denoted as such.
